The Types Of Puppets

The realm of puppetry is vast, encompassing various types of puppets, each with unique techniques and characters. Understanding these types will deepen our appreciation for the craft and help clarify who possesses the puppet.

Marionettes

Marionettes are perhaps the most recognized form of puppetry. Controlled by strings or wires connected to a framework or control bar, marionettes can perform complex movements, mimicking human actions with uncanny precision. The puppeteer stands above, mastering the strings to breathe life into the character.

Hand Puppets

Hand puppets, or glove puppets, are manipulated by the puppeteer’s hand. The puppeteer’s fingers operate the puppet’s limbs, allowing for a more intimate connection between performer and character. Hand puppets are often used in children’s theater due to their simplicity and ease of movement.

Shadow Puppets

Shadow puppets, originating from regions such as Indonesia and India, utilize light to cast shadows of flat figures. The puppeteer positions the puppet between a light source and a screen, creating a narrative through shadows. This technique highlights the creativity involved in storytelling without physical manipulation.

Rod Puppets

Rod puppets are operated with rods connected to various parts of the puppet body. This style allows for more intricate movements than hand puppets while maintaining a direct connection to the puppeteer.
